Hi All,
Does any body knows the difference between cat 4000 and cat 4500 ? specially in IOS software? Thank You!

Power supplies are different. With 4500 series, you'll not need an external power shelf/PEM to supply inline power to IP Phones/access points. Also, 4507R can support dual supervisor 4 Engines
